The National Monuments Record of Wales records Twyn Talycefn, Marker Cairn II as Marker Cairn from the Modern period. The saved point comes from the official national record. Inclusion does not by itself mean that the public may enter the place.
Marker cairn; Modern period. It serves as a survey or boundary marker, reflecting later historical land management practices rather than a prehistoric funerary or ritual structure.
